2 candidates are tracked for DuPage County Clerk on the November 3, 2026 ballot: Paula Deacon Garcia and Patricia Kladis-Schiappa. Candidate information follows official Dupage County election filings; verify with the official election office linked below.

DuPage County Board member Paula Deacon Garcia won the Democratic nomination over sitting County Clerk Jean Kaczmarek, 56.53 percent to 43.47 percent, in the March 17 primary; Patricia Kladis-Schiappa ran unopposed for the Republican nomination. They meet on the November 3 ballot, per the county's official canvass.

Paula Deacon Garcia

Democratic

Paula Deacon Garcia worked 21 years for the Village of Lisle's Development Services/Building Department before her election to the DuPage County Board's District 2 seat in 2020, where she chairs the Finance Committee, per Paula Deacon Garcia campaign site.

Patricia Kladis-Schiappa

Republican

Patricia Kladis-Schiappa is a Burr Ridge attorney with more than 20 years concentrating her trial and appellate practice in workers' compensation law, per Patricia Kladis-Schiappa campaign site.
